If you notice cracks or chips on your windscreen, it's essential to act quickly and get a professional to examine the damage. Depending on the extent of the chip or crack you may require a windscreen replacement.

You could also get windscreen repair in Maidstone. The technician will inject resin into the cracks or chips to seal them off and prevent further cracking. The procedure is easy and usually takes less than an hour, and is done from the comfort of your home or garage.

It is crucial to address any crack or chip immediately. If left unattended the damage can become larger and become more serious with time. This can cause security issues and could cause a failed MOT test.

Windscreens are extremely brittle and can be damaged quickly by the stress and vibrations that occur when they are on the road. It is possible to prevent damage from occurring by having your windscreen repaired or replaced. This can also save you money in the long-term.

You can make your own DIY windscreen repair kit to repair a small crack, but it's not always the best solution. Since resin can get messy and smudge the screen it is worth hiring an expert.

Window Repair

Windows are essential for the appearance of your house, but they are also an important contributor to your energy bills. Broken glass, decaying wood and damaged seals may raise your energy bills. They let in cool air, humidity , and insects.

Fortunately, most window issues can be repaired without replacing the entire unit. In some cases however, it may be necessary to replace the entire unit.

The most obvious sign of window damage is a hole or crack in the panes. These can occur as a result of throwing projectiles, stray baseballs or extreme weather conditions therefore be certain to inspect them frequently.

You'll need to replace the wood when the hole or crack extends over one inch. You can use an epoxy wood filler for smaller areas. Be sure to read the directions of the manufacturer prior to making use of it.

When the frame is dry clean any old caulk from around the edges of the window. It is crucial to change the caulk you have used since it could cause other problems like water penetration or air leaks in your home.

The next step is to prepare the glass to be refracted. Depending on the kind of window frame, you will need a putty wire brush or knife to clean any dirt, stains, and other debris. To soften the old putty, you may also use a heating gun. This will make it easier to get rid of.

Before you put in the new pane, you must make sure that it fits inside the rabbet. If it doesn't, cut a sealing tape to the correct size and press the pane in place.

If your window is made of aluminum, you can usually replace the glass without having to remove the sash. If your window is a sliding one, you can remove the sash from the side or the bottom. Then, remove the vinyl strip that holds your window in place with the flat-head screwdriver or a sharp edge of putty knife.
